رُوِيَ عَنْ أَيُّوبَ بْنِ نُوحٍ قَالَ

كَتَبَ عَلِيُّ بْنُ شُعَيْبٍ إِلَى أَبِي الْحَسَنِ ع امْرَأَةٌ أَرْضَعَتْ بَعْضَ وُلْدِي هَلْ يَجُوزُ لِي أَنْ أَتَزَوَّجَ بَعْضَ وُلْدِهَا فَكَتَبَ لَا يَجُوزُ ذَلِكَ لِأَنَّ وُلْدَهَا قَدْ صَارَ بِمَنْزِلَةِ وُلْدِكَ.

Hadith.4668 - It was narrated from Ayyub ibn Nuh who said: Ali ibn Shu'ayb wrote to Abu al-Hasan (as) asking: "A woman breastfed one of my children. Is it permissible for me to marry one of her children?" Imam (as) wrote in response, "That is not permissible because her children have become like your own children."
